These are the four Movies that will premiere this summer on Hallmark Channel’s Christmas In July 2026:
Christmas Under Construction – July 4 at 8/7c: While doing a Christmas renovation for a cozy New Hampshire cabin, Chelsea, the star of a hit reality show, Renovation Romance, finds an unexpected connection with the cabin’s owner, Cooper. Stars Daniel Lissing and Jessica Lowndes, who are teaming up for the first time since they starred in the fan-favorite Christmas movie December Bride.
O Little Christmas Market – July 11 at 8/7c: An artist’s fight to save her town’s beloved Christmas market from a developer, but a budding romance with the architect tied to the deal may help bring about a Christmas miracle. Stars Katherine Barrell and Stephen Huszar.
Snowbound for the Holidays – July 18 at 8/7c: Hotel manager Cassidy Evergreen evaluates a cozy ski lodge, but Christmas magic—and its charming owner, Trey Sanderson—turn a simple assignment into a heartfelt choice between duty and love. Stars Marcus Rosner and Vanessa Lengies
Love Under the Mistletoe – July 25 at 8/7c: Grace and her former high school crush, Ryan, work together to revive the beloved charity fundraiser and seem to constantly find themselves under strategically placed mistletoe. Stars Jen Lilley and Nick Bateman




On July 1, 2026, Christmas at Sea will premiere on Hallmark+. The passengers aboard the Hallmark Cruise are ecstatic when they come face to face with all of their favorite Hallmark stars, who offer advice and support on their journeys.
Get ready for another adventure on the high seas as Hallmark superfans meet their favorite stars on a Christmas cruise to Cozumel, Mexico. With holiday cheer, unforgettable moments, and celebrity surprises, this cruise is one to remember.
